Nikon-CrEST Spinning disk system
Key specifications and features
- Resolution: 100X Plan Apo Lambda 1.45 objective and 70 μm pinhole: 250 nm lateral; 650 nm axial
- Disk Speed: 15.000 rpm standard, 20.000 rpm version possible
- Illumination: LED – Spectra X (Lumencor) or CAIRN Laser unit
- Single or dual pattern option, up to 22mm FOV (single pattern)
- Pattern pinhole size: 40 μm (for low NA objectives) and/or 70 μm (for high NA objectives). Custom size and pattern on request
- Ease of use: NIS Elements driven interface. Easy pattern focusing
- Objective compatibility: 100X, 60X, 40X
- Possibility for: VCS hardware resolution enhancement or deconvolution software resolution enhancement with NIS Elements software
Technology
- CrEST spinning disk uses a proprietary NA dependent pinhole pattern for maximum confocality and higher S/N ratios
- Single pattern (1 pinhole size, large FOV) or dual pattern (2 pinhole sizes, but smaller FOV)
- Motorized widefield to confocal switchover while spinning
- Easy Gimbal mount for quick alignment and best S/N
- Continuous spiral pattern available for higher throughput
- Motorized dichroic and emitter filter wheels
